TITAN IMPERIAL STOUT
Fermentables
Ingredient Amount % MCU When
UK Pale Ale Malt 7.894 kg 69.4 % 8.2 In Mash/Steeped
UK Roasted Barley 0.782 kg 6.9 % 174.1 In Mash/Steeped
UK Amber Malt 0.775 kg 6.8 % 5.4 In Mash/Steeped
UK Wheat Malt 0.483 kg 4.2 % 0.3 In Mash/Steeped
UK Flaked Barley 0.483 kg 4.2 % 0.2 In Mash/Steeped
UK Chocolate Malt 0.429 kg 3.8 % 67.1 In Mash/Steeped
UK Oat malt 0.258 kg 2.3 % 0.3 In Mash/Steeped
Belgian Special B 0.182 kg 1.6 % 9.3 In Mash/Steeped
UK Black Malt 0.086 kg 0.8 % 16.1 In Mash/Steeped
Hops
Variety Alpha Amount IBU Form When
US Summit 18.0 % 30 g 40.2 Loose Whole Hops First Wort Hopped
US Chinook 10.5 % 10 g 7.8 Loose Whole Hops First Wort Hopped
US Magnum 16.0 % 20 g 23.8 Loose Whole Hops 60 Min From End
US Centennial 8.5 % 25 g 7.9 Loose Whole Hops 15 Min From End
US Centennial 8.5 % 25 g 3.2 Loose Whole Hops 5 Min From End
Yeast
500ml WLP090-San Diego Super Yeast slurry from Uylsses 31
